Computational Field Analysis of Bulk-Slotted Gold based Hybrid Plasmonic SOI Ring Resonator

Abstract

The electromagnetic excitations propagating in a wave-like manner along the interface between two different media and evanescently confined in the direction perpendicular to the interface are known as surface plasmons [1], [2], [3]. In this manuscript, propagation of Electric and Magnetic fields are analysed for hybrid Plasmonic ring waveguide. A plasmonic ring waveguide based on Silicon-on-insulator technology is taken in to consideration consisting of a 220 nm vertical height fabrication technology. The ring structure comprises of a bulk Gold (Au) material at the central ring cavity with a slot adjacent to silicon material is analysed for its field and intensity propagation.
